I'm new to the site and I tried to look through the files to old questions, but I couldn't find the answer.

What is the nameserver for a blablabla.x10hosting.com?
And to set my site account up to a domain, is all I have to do is change the namerserver?

The nameservers for x10Hosting is:
Code:
ns1.x10hosting.com
ns2.x10hosting.com

All you have to do is add your domain to your hosting account via the x10Hosting Account Panel, and then change the nameservers of your domain to the ones I gave to you.

Nameservers should set to ns1.x10hosting.com and ns2.x10hosting.com, Once they are changed, login to www.x10hosting.com/login and find the "Account Details" section, check the box to use your own domain and enter it there. Or, you can "Park" it in the cPanel section of your website to keep your existing domain as your main one.
